- Chemical TaxonomyProvided by Classyfire
- Description
- This compound belongs to the class of organic compounds known as pyrrolocarbazoles. These are compounds containing a pyrrolocarbazole moiety, which is a tetracyclic heterocycle which consists of a pyrrole ring fused to a carbazole.
